Home
last modified time | relevance | path

Searched refs:fis (Results 1 – 25 of 47) sorted by relevance

12

/linux/drivers/block/mtip32xx/
A Dmtip32xx.c862 (fis->features == 0x27 || fis->features == 0x72 || in mtip_pause_ncq()
863 fis->features == 0x62 || fis->features == 0x26))) { in mtip_pause_ncq()
1152 &fis, in mtip_get_identify()
1229 &fis, in mtip_standby_immediate()
1274 &fis, in mtip_read_log_page()
1308 &fis, in mtip_get_smart_data()
1520 &fis, in exec_drive_task()
1614 &fis, in exec_drive_command()
1829 fis.command, in exec_drive_taskfile()
1834 fis.lba_hi, in exec_drive_taskfile()
[all …]
/linux/drivers/ata/
A Dlibata-sata.c159 fis[4] = tf->lbal; in ata_tf_to_fis()
160 fis[5] = tf->lbam; in ata_tf_to_fis()
161 fis[6] = tf->lbah; in ata_tf_to_fis()
162 fis[7] = tf->device; in ata_tf_to_fis()
169 fis[12] = tf->nsect; in ata_tf_to_fis()
171 fis[14] = 0; in ata_tf_to_fis()
172 fis[15] = tf->ctl; in ata_tf_to_fis()
197 tf->lbal = fis[4]; in ata_tf_from_fis()
198 tf->lbam = fis[5]; in ata_tf_from_fis()
199 tf->lbah = fis[6]; in ata_tf_from_fis()
[all …]
A Dsata_nv.c1751 writew(fis, pp->irq_block); in nv_swncq_irq_clear()
2066 if (fis & NV_SWNCQ_IRQ_ADDED) in nv_swncq_hotplug()
2068 else if (fis & NV_SWNCQ_IRQ_REMOVED) in nv_swncq_hotplug()
2202 nv_swncq_irq_clear(ap, fis); in nv_swncq_host_interrupt()
2203 if (!fis) in nv_swncq_host_interrupt()
2209 if (fis & NV_SWNCQ_IRQ_HOTPLUG) { in nv_swncq_host_interrupt()
2210 nv_swncq_hotplug(ap, fis); in nv_swncq_host_interrupt()
2231 if (fis & NV_SWNCQ_IRQ_BACKOUT) { in nv_swncq_host_interrupt()
2238 if (fis & NV_SWNCQ_IRQ_SDBFIS) { in nv_swncq_host_interrupt()
2248 if (fis & NV_SWNCQ_IRQ_DHREGFIS) { in nv_swncq_host_interrupt()
[all …]
A Dsata_sil24.c33 u8 fis[6 * 4]; member
486 u8 fis[6 * 4]; in sil24_read_tf() local
489 memcpy_fromio(fis, prb->fis, sizeof(fis)); in sil24_read_tf()
490 ata_tf_from_fis(fis, tf); in sil24_read_tf()
610 ata_tf_to_fis(tf, pmp, is_cmd, prb->fis); in sil24_exec_polled_cmd()
876 ata_tf_to_fis(&qc->tf, qc->dev->link->pmp, 1, prb->fis); in sil24_qc_prep()
/linux/Documentation/devicetree/bindings/mtd/partitions/
A Dredboot-fis.yaml4 $id: http://devicetree.org/schemas/mtd/partitions/redboot-fis.yaml#
21 const: redboot-fis
23 fis-index-block:
31 - fis-index-block
39 compatible = "redboot-fis";
40 fis-index-block = <0>;
/linux/Documentation/arm/sa1100/
A Dassabet.rst77 fis init -f
99 fis create "Linux kernel" -b 0x100000 -l 0xc0000
115 fis load "Linux kernel"
149 fis free
153 RedBoot> fis free
168 fis unlock -f 0x500E0000 -l 0x2e0000
169 fis erase -f 0x500E0000 -l 0x2e0000
170 fis write -b 0x100000 -l 0x277424 -f 0x500E0000
171 fis create "JFFS2" -n -f 0x500E0000 -l 0x2e0000
177 RedBoot> fis list
[all …]
/linux/drivers/scsi/libsas/
A Dsas_ata.c123 memcpy(dev->sata_dev.fis, resp->ending_fis, ATA_RESP_FIS_SIZE); in sas_ata_task_done()
126 qc->err_mask |= ac_err_mask(dev->sata_dev.fis[2]); in sas_ata_task_done()
128 link->eh_info.err_mask |= ac_err_mask(dev->sata_dev.fis[2]); in sas_ata_task_done()
144 dev->sata_dev.fis[3] = 0x04; /* status err */ in sas_ata_task_done()
145 dev->sata_dev.fis[2] = ATA_ERR; in sas_ata_task_done()
193 ata_tf_to_fis(&qc->tf, qc->dev->link->pmp, 1, (u8 *)&task->ata_task.fis); in sas_ata_qc_issue()
241 ata_tf_from_fis(dev->sata_dev.fis, &qc->result_tf); in sas_ata_qc_fill_rtf()
273 memcpy(dev->frame_rcvd, &dev->sata_dev.rps_resp.rps.fis, in sas_get_ata_info()
613 struct dev_to_host_fis *fis = in sas_get_ata_command_set() local
620 ata_tf_from_fis((const u8 *)fis, &tf); in sas_get_ata_command_set()
A Dsas_discover.c75 struct dev_to_host_fis *fis = in sas_get_port_device() local
77 if (fis->interrupt_reason == 1 && fis->lbal == 1 && in sas_get_port_device()
78 fis->byte_count_low == 0x69 && fis->byte_count_high == 0x96 in sas_get_port_device()
79 && (fis->device & ~0x10) == 0) in sas_get_port_device()
A Dsas_host_smp.c141 struct dev_to_host_fis *fis; in sas_report_phy_sata() local
155 fis = (struct dev_to_host_fis *) in sas_report_phy_sata()
166 if (fis->fis_type != 0x34) in sas_report_phy_sata()
/linux/arch/arm/boot/dts/
A Dintel-ixp46x-ixdp465.dts30 compatible = "redboot-fis";
32 fis-index-block = <0xff>;
A Dintel-ixp43x-kixrp435.dts30 compatible = "redboot-fis";
32 fis-index-block = <0x7f>;
A Dintel-ixp42x-ixdp425.dts34 compatible = "redboot-fis";
36 fis-index-block = <0x7f>;
A Dgemini-ssi1328.dts78 compatible = "redboot-fis";
80 fis-index-block = <0x7F>;
A Dintel-ixp42x-netgear-wg302v2.dts50 compatible = "redboot-fis";
52 fis-index-block = <0xff>;
A Dintel-ixp42x-adi-coyote.dts51 compatible = "redboot-fis";
53 fis-index-block = <0x1ff>;
A Dintel-ixp42x-iomega-nas100d.dts104 compatible = "redboot-fis";
106 fis-index-block = <0x3f>;
A Dintel-ixp42x-ixdpg425.dts56 compatible = "redboot-fis";
58 fis-index-block = <0x7f>;
A Dintel-ixp42x-dlink-dsm-g600.dts114 compatible = "redboot-fis";
119 fis-index-block = <0x7f>;
A Dgemini-nas4220b.dts85 compatible = "redboot-fis";
87 fis-index-block = <0x1fc>;
A Dintel-ixp42x-freecom-fsg-3.dts95 compatible = "redboot-fis";
97 fis-index-block = <0x1f>;
A Dintel-ixp42x-linksys-nslu2.dts111 compatible = "redboot-fis";
113 fis-index-block = <0x3f>;
A Dintel-ixp42x-arcom-vulcan.dts60 compatible = "redboot-fis";
61 fis-index-block = <0x1ff>;
/linux/drivers/scsi/isci/
A Drequest.h306 task->ata_task.fis.command == ATA_CMD_READ_LOG_EXT && in isci_task_is_ncq_recovery()
307 task->ata_task.fis.lbal == ATA_LOG_SATA_NCQ); in isci_task_is_ncq_recovery()
A Drequest.c693 task->ata_task.fis.command == ATA_CMD_PACKET) { in sci_io_request_construct_sata()
2709 static void isci_process_stp_response(struct sas_task *task, struct dev_to_host_fis *fis) in isci_process_stp_response() argument
2714 resp->frame_len = sizeof(*fis); in isci_process_stp_response()
2715 memcpy(resp->ending_fis, fis, sizeof(*fis)); in isci_process_stp_response()
2719 if (ac_err_mask(fis->status)) in isci_process_stp_response()
2976 task->ata_task.fis.command == ATA_CMD_PACKET) { in sci_request_started_state_enter()
3147 struct host_to_dev_fis *fis = &ireq->stp.cmd; in isci_request_stp_request_construct() local
3156 memcpy(fis, &task->ata_task.fis, sizeof(struct host_to_dev_fis)); in isci_request_stp_request_construct()
3158 fis->flags |= 0x80; in isci_request_stp_request_construct()
3159 fis->flags &= 0xF0; in isci_request_stp_request_construct()
[all …]
/linux/drivers/scsi/aic94xx/
A Daic94xx_task.c368 scb->ata_task.fis = task->ata_task.fis; in asd_build_ata_ascb()
370 scb->ata_task.fis.flags |= 0x80; /* C=1: update ATA cmd reg */ in asd_build_ata_ascb()
371 scb->ata_task.fis.flags &= 0xF0; /* PM_PORT field shall be 0 */ in asd_build_ata_ascb()

Completed in 36 milliseconds

12